Physics in the Sixth Form

A Level Physics develops a knowledge and understanding of the subject and its use in present day society. Many new techniques are learnt including data logging and the use of computers to analyse results. During the AS course a Medical Physics unit is studied which makes Physics a particularly valuable and useful subject for those intending to study medicine, veterinary science, other sciences, mathematics and many other subjects.

Physicists are renowned for their analytical skills and their ability to present and follow a logical argument. This makes A Level Physics a good subject for students going on to many careers including law, economics and business management.

Students of A Level Physics may continue their study of Physics at University, often in specialist areas like astrophysics, or in related areas like engineering, cybernetics, architecture or computer science. Many A Level physicists go on to study medicine, veterinary science, physiotherapy and other related courses, where their knowledge of physics is of great help in understanding the technology used in diagnosis and treatment.
